Action item: The Relayn deploy-status bot silently dropped updates when the pipeline API paginated results, so responders believed a rollback had completed when it had not. We will add pagination handling, a staleness banner, and an integration test. Until merged, verify deploy state directly in the pipeline console, documented at the page below.

runbook for kahop-kajop: https://rundeck.ordinio.test/display/secrets/pipeline/issue/pages/repo/browse/e5732776e07d1285107e5aeb

While preparing evidence for the Brightlark color-contrast accessibility audit, the Hollowpine credentials vault entered a lockout state after repeated failed unlock attempts by the audit tooling. The vault contains the annotated contrast reports and the signing material for the audit attestation. Per policy, I am escalating to security review rather than resetting the vault myself. All access attempts are captured in the Hollowpine event log. To proceed with the supervised unlock, use the recovery passphrase provided below.

vault phrase of kawep-tahog = ulaix-briath

Effective Monday, responsibility for the telemetry payload compressor in Pylonix Relay moves off my plate. This covers the zstd dictionary rotation, the schema-aware field packing, and the decompression bounds checks flagged in last quarter's review. Open items: the dictionary update path still lacks integrity verification, and the fuzz suite needs re-enabling in CI. Route all security findings and threat-model questions to the new owner rather than me. The role transfers to the engineer named below.

account owner for bawip-fajeg: Ralix Oliwyn